Why kali_network_nmap_scan is rated High

This tool executes active network reconnaissance operations against target systems. NSE script execution in particular can trigger external operations beyond passive scanning. While positioned as authorized penetration testing, misuse could expose network topology, open ports, and OS details of unintended targets.

From the tool's definition 'Perform network port scanning using Nmap' with capabilities including 'TCP SYN, Connect, UDP, and stealth scans', 'Service version detection', 'OS fingerprinting', and 'NSE script execution'

What does the kali_network_nmap_scan tool do? +

Perform network port scanning using Nmap. Nmap (Network Mapper) is a powerful network scanner for discovering hosts, services, and potential vulnerabilities. Capabilities: - TCP SYN, Connect, UDP, and stealth scans - Service version detection (-sV) - OS fingerprinting (-O, requires root) - NSE script execution - Multiple output formats Usage Notes: - TCP SYN scan requires root privileges - Use appropriate timing for stealth vs speed - Large port ranges increase scan time significantly Example: - Quick scan: target=.
